Output 3698ff397db05ad4449272e23eb40158f64ec92a255b11738d8d2857fe3ac961:10

value
166319327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334380e666138cc6bdbb48fe757a07aa722798c7 OP_EQUAL
address
36N5FZ4YdBSP5SWM4ze7W6CRk3Xb29yj8s
transaction
3698ff397db05ad4449272e23eb40158f64ec92a255b11738d8d2857fe3ac961
confirmations
502320
spent
true